Louisiana Bridge Builders (“LBB”) is designing and building the new I-10 Calcasieu River Bridge in Lake Charles, Louisiana (USA) for the Louisiana Department of Transportation and Development (LADOTD). LBB will also be responsible for the reconstruction of interstate highway, various structures, ramps, and approaches for a 5.5 mile stretch between I-210 West End and Ryan Street.

POSITION PURPOSE/SUMMARY 

The Warehouse Coordinator is committed to supporting Louisiana Bridge Builders by overseeing the daily operations of the warehouse by maintaining inventory accuracy, coordinating shipments, and ensuring compliance with safety and organizational standards.

LOCATION 

This position is based in Lake Charles, LA.  

PRIMARY D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ES 

  1. Coordinate daily warehouse activities, including receiving, storing, and shipping products
  2. Maintain accurate inventory records using warehouse management systems
  3. Schedule and track inbound and outbound shipments to ensure timely delivery.
  4. Conduct regular inventory audits and cycle counts to prevent stock discrepancies.
  5. Collaborate with procurement, production, and logistics teams to optimize inventory flow.
  6. Monitor and maintain all warehouse equipment in coordination with the equipment team.
  7. Ensure proper labeling, documentation, and handling of materials according to company and regulatory requirements.
  8. Maintain cleanliness, organization, and safety standards in the warehouse.
  9. Monitor and optimize warehouse space utilization and workflow.
  10. Prepare and submit reports on inventory levels, shipments, and operational efficiency.
  11. Operate and maintain warehouse equipment such as forklifts & pallet jacks.
  12. Performing all other duties and responsibilities as assigned.
